The first four episodes of Season 5 of Game of Thrones have leaked online, with rumours of more to follow. The timing is devastating for HBO, with the channel debuting Season 5 of the critically-acclaimed show both on cable and its new live streaming platform, HBO Now.
Game of Thrones is already the most illegally downloaded show in history, and after the appearance of the four episodes online early on Sunday morning, they have been downloaded over 50,000 times, with that number rising all the time.
After finding the first episode on an undisclosed torrent site and watching the first few seconds (for science), I can reveal that the video file is 480p and watermarked, so – assuming the other three episodes are of a similar format – quality purists (of which I am one) might be best advised to wait.
